2025年2月28日

Linux 中的 cd 命令:7 个实际示例

Linux 中的 cd 命令:7 个实际示例 通过这些实际示例,学习如何在 Linux 中充分发挥 cd 命令的潜力。命令 cd 用于在 Linux 中的目录之间导航。它代表“更改目录”。它使您能够将工作目录从当前目录更改为您想要导航到的所需目录。cd 命令的语法如下:cd [option] <directory>[option] 用于控制命令的输出。大多数时候您不会使用这些选项。cd 命令的可用选项与符号链接相关:-P:不要遵循符号链接。-L:遵循符号链接。 是您指定要导航到的所需目录的路径的位置。在我们开始更多地研究 cd 命令之前,我建议重新审视 Linux 中绝对路径和相对路径的概念。您将通过 cd 命令经常使用它们。Linux 中 cd 命令的 7 个基本示例以下是 cd 命令最常见的用法。其中一些您可能已经知道。其中一些虽然不那么受欢迎但非常有用。?…
2025年2月28日

如何修复 RHEL/CentOS 7 中的“firewall-cmd:找不到命令”错误

如何修复 RHEL/CentOS 7 中的“firewall-cmd:找不到命令”错误 firewall-cmd是firewalld(firewalld守护进程)的命令行前端,它是一个具有D-Bus接口的动态防火墙管理工具。同时支持IPv4和IPv6;它还支持网络防火墙区域、网桥和 ipset。它允许在区域中执行定时防火墙规则、记录拒绝的数据包、自动加载内核模块以及许多其他功能。Firewalld 使用运行时和永久配置选项,您可以使用firewall-cmd 进行管理。在本文中,我们将解释如何解决 RHEL/CentOS 7 Linux 系统上的“firewall-cmd:找不到命令”错误。另请阅读:在 Linux 中配置和管理防火墙的有用“FirewallD”规则我们在新推出的 AWS (Amazon Web Services) EC2 (弹性云…
2025年2月28日

如何在 Rocky Linux 9 上安装 InfluxDB 和 Telegraf

如何在 Rocky Linux 9 上安装 InfluxDB 和 Telegraf 在此页 先决条件 设置存储库 安装 InfluxDB 安装 influxdb CLI 通过 InfluxDB CLI 配置 InfluxDB 使用 TLS 保护 InfluxDB 通过 Telegraf 收集数据 可视化数据和创建仪表板 结论 InfluxDB 是一个用 Go 编写的开源时间序列数据库。它是一个高性能的时间序列平台,专门用于收集、存储、处理和可视化时间序列数据。 InfluxDB 是时序数据库的首选解决方案,它提供了一个高性能的时序数据引擎,内置强大的 API 用于构建实时应用程序。 InfluxDB 是一个用于操作监控、应用程序和服务器性能指标、物联网传感器数据和实时分析的平台。在本教程中,您将在 Rocky Linux 9 服务器上安装 influxdb 开源时间序列数据库和 Telegraf。您还…
2025年2月28日

如何在 RHEL 8 中启用 RHEL 订阅?

如何在 RHEL 8 中启用 RHEL 订阅? 介绍红帽企业 Linux (RHEL) 8 是企业界流行且广泛使用的操作系统。它以其稳定性、安全性和性能而闻名。 RHEL 8 于 2019 年 5 月发布,带来了许多新功能和改进。它建立在模块化架构之上,允许用户挑选他们想要使用的组件。 RHEL 8 的一个重要方面是其订阅模式。为了使用 RHEL 8,用户必须拥有有效的订阅,才能访问软件更新、安全补丁、技术支持和其他资源。订阅模式确保红帽能够持续投入RHEL 8的开发,为客户提供高质量的产品。启用 RHEL 订阅的重要性如果您想让系统保持最新的软件更新、安全补丁和错误修复,那么启用 RHEL 订阅至关重要。如果没有有效的订阅,您将无法从红帽访问这些资源或获得其团队的技术支持。此外,使用未注册或过期版本的 RHEL 可能会使您的系统面临潜在的安全风险,可能会损害您的数据…
2025年2月28日

如何在Linux命令行中检查CentOS版本

如何在Linux命令行中检查CentOS版本 您可以通过以下几种方式检查计算机上运行的 CentOS Linux 发行版的版本。对于服务器软件来说,CentOS 是一个很棒的操作系统,因为它们有更长的支持周期,并且在存储库和更大的社区中拥有非常稳定的软件。要了解更多有关为什么 CentOS 更好的信息,请查看此页面。大多数情况下,在安装或选择软件包时,需要了解系统中运行的CentOS版本,以避免依赖不匹配等问题。在本教程中,我将向您展示一些检查 CentOS 版本的方法。如何查看CentOS版本要检查 CentOS 版本,您可以使用如下命令:lsb_release -d结果将为您提供 CentOS 版本号。linux@handbook:~$ lsb_release -d Description: CentOS Linux release 7.14.12…
2025年2月28日

如何启用或禁用 SELinux 布尔值

如何启用或禁用 SELinux 布尔值 安全增强型 Linux (SELinux) 是一种在 Linux 内核中实现的强制访问控制 (MAC) 安全机制。这是一种灵活的操作,旨在提高整体系统安全性:它可以使用系统上加载的策略来实施访问控制,而普通用户或行为不当的程序可能无法更改该策略。下面的文章清楚地解释了 SELinux 以及如何在 Linux 系统中实现它。在 Linux 中使用 SELinux 或 AppArmor 实施强制访问控制在本文中,我们将向您展示如何在 CentOS、RHEL 和 Fedora Linux 发行版中打开或关闭 SELinux 布尔值。要查看所有 SELinux 布尔值,请结合使用 getsebool 命令 和 less 命令。注意:SELinux 必须处于启用状态才能列出所有布尔值。getsebool -a | less 要查看特定程序(或守护程序)的所有…
2025年2月28日

如何在 Debian 11 上安装 OpenMRS(开放医疗记录系统)

如何在 Debian 11 上安装 OpenMRS(开放医疗记录系统) 在此页 先决条件 安装 Java 8 安装 MySQL 服务器 5.6 安装 Tomcat 7 为 Tomcat 创建一个 Systemd 服务文件 安装 OpenMRS 访问 OpenMRS 安装向导 结论 OpenMRS 全称是“Open Medical Record System”,是一个免费、开源、高效的电子病历 (EMR) 存储和检索系统。它用于治疗发展中国家数百万艾滋病毒/艾滋病和肺结核 (TB) 患者。其主要目标是开发用于在发展中国家提供医疗保健的软件。它允许与其他医疗信息系统交换患者数据。它是用 Java 编写的,提供了一个用户友好的 Web 仪表板,用于通过 Web 浏览器管理电子病历。在这篇文章中,我们将向您展示如何在 Debian 11 上安装 OpenMRS 医疗记录系统。先决条件 运行 Debian 11 的服务器…
2025年2月28日

如何在 RHEL/CentOS 8 中启用 RPMForge 存储库?

如何在 RHEL/CentOS 8 中启用 RPMForge 存储库? 介绍RPMForge 存储库是一个第三方软件包存储库,其中包含 RHEL/CentOS 8 默认存储库中不可用的各种软件包。该存储库提供了可以安装在系统上以增强系统性能的附加软件包、更新和补丁。功能和性能。通过启用 RPMForge,您将可以访问其他方式无法使用的大量适用于 RHEL/CentOS 8 的软件包。在 RHEL/CentOS 8 中启用 RPMForge 存储库很重要的主要原因之一是它提供了对系统管理员和开发人员必需的软件包的访问。检查现有存储库在启用 RPMForge 存储库之前,检查 RHEL/CentOS 系统上是否已启用任何现有存储库非常重要。这是必要的,因为启用多个存储库可能会导致软件包安装期间发生冲突和错误。检查现有存储库的最简单方法是使用 yum repolis…
2025年2月28日

如何在 Ubuntu 和其他 Linux 发行版上安装 Ansible

如何在 Ubuntu 和其他 Linux 发行版上安装 Ansible 了解如何以清晰、准确的步骤在 Linux 上安装 Ansible。本教程适用于 Ubuntu、Debian、CentOS、Red Hat、SUSE 等。如今,Ansible 已成为 IT 行业的热门词汇。它是一种用于 IT 编排的激进的自动化 DevOps 工具。Ansible 是 Red Hat 的开源工具。它有助于配置、配置、部署和管理您的系统基础设施,而不会遇到任何麻烦。Ansible 是无代理的,不需要额外的软件。它可以通过 SSH、远程 PowerShell 和远程 API 进行连接。它还使用一种人类可读的语言 YAML,以便人们可以轻松地适应 Ansible。通过 Ansible,您可以在完整的软件包中获得系统自动化所需的一切。如何在 Linux 上安装 Ansible在第一篇关于 Ansible 的…
2025年2月28日

如何在 Ubuntu 22.04 上安装 ERPNext

如何在 Ubuntu 22.04 上安装 ERPNext 本教程适用于这些操作系统版本Ubuntu 22.04(果酱水母)Ubuntu 18.04(仿生海狸)在此页 先决条件 开始 安装和配置 MariaDB 数据库 在 Ubuntu 22.04 上安装 ERPNext 为生产环境配置 ERPNext 访问 ERPNext 网络用户界面 使用 Lets Encrypt SSL 保护 ERPNext 结论 ERPNext 是一种免费的开源 ERP 软件,供制造商、分销商和服务商使用。它是用 Python、JavaScript 和 Frappe 框架构建的。它是现代的、易于使用的、免费的,专为中小型企业设计,可帮助公司管理其业务运营的各个方面。全球数以千计的企业使用它来管理他们的 ERP 流程。它是支持制造、分销、零售、贸易、服务、教育、非营利组织等的最佳 ERP 系统之一。在本教程中,我们将向…